Surf Spot Of The Week: Porthtowan Beach
Porthtowan is one of Cornwall’s most popular surf beaches, tucked into a dramatic valley on the north coast between St Agnes and Portreath. Its west-facing beach gets plenty of Atlantic swell, making it a reliable option when the conditions are right.

Surf Spot Of The Week: Croyde Bay
Croyde is one of North Devon’s most famous and powerful beach breaks, sitting in a beautiful horseshoe-shaped bay that consistently picks up Atlantic swell. On its day, it delivers fast, hollow and punchy waves that have earned it a reputation as one of the UK’s most well-known heavy beach breaks.
